Transaction 531e9d6221fbb199e58db38f3e5d496d04d86d96baddf5fec0b017b5c4a95de1
1 Input
2 Outputs
- 531e9d6221fbb199e58db38f3e5d496d04d86d96baddf5fec0b017b5c4a95de1:0
- 531e9d6221fbb199e58db38f3e5d496d04d86d96baddf5fec0b017b5c4a95de1:1
value 23831200
address 3C59Q5Vfff43HRThoFoBmved6MSwymsDre
value 1156909
address 3BcNJ5Kw2ANZ2H2JFq3kaL6UUjCNpAr77j